Caru’ cu Bere is one of the oldest restaurants in Bucharest, in fact it is the city’s oldest brewery. It was opened in 1879 in the old Zlatari inn and moved to Stavropoleos Street (its current location) twenty years later. The food lacks the quality it once had, but the house beer is still good [...]
